The Teledyne LeCroy DL02-HCM Differential Probe is a high-performance accessory designed for engineers and technicians who require precise differential signal measurements. With a bandwidth of 250 MHz and an ultra-low input capacitance of 0.6 pF, this probe minimizes loading on the circuit under test, ensuring signal integrity. The selectable attenuation ratios (7.8X, 17.5X, 70X) provide flexibility to match a wide range of signal amplitudes, while the ProBus interface ensures seamless connectivity with compatible oscilloscopes.

Applications
The DL02-HCM is ideal for a variety of applications including power electronics design, motor drive analysis, and high-speed digital design. Its low capacitance and high bandwidth make it suitable for measuring signals in high-impedance circuits, while the selectable attenuation allows for safe measurement of voltages up to 60 V.
